Megosztás a következőn keresztül:


Strukturálatlan dokumentumfeldolgozási modellek exportálása és importálása a PowerShell-lel

A következőkre vonatkozik: ✓ Strukturálatlan dokumentumfeldolgozás

Fontos

A Microsoft Syntex PowerShell-parancsmagok és az összes többi PnP-összetevő nyílt forráskódú eszközök, amelyeket egy aktív közösség támogat, amely támogatást nyújt számukra. A Microsoft hivatalos támogatási csatornái nem támogatják a nyílt forráskódú eszközök SLA-ját.

A Syntex-modellek exportálhatók PnP-sablonként, így újra felhasználhatók a tartalomközpontokban vagy bérlőkben.

Az összes modell exportálása egy tartalomközpontban

Ha a tartalomközpontban lévő összes strukturálatlan dokumentumfeldolgozási modellt egyetlen PnP-sablonba szeretné exportálni, használja a következő PnP PowerShell-parancsmagokat :

Connect-PnPOnline -Url "https://contoso.sharepoint.com/sites/yourContentCenter"

Get-PnPSiteTemplate -Out MyModels.pnp -Handlers SyntexModels

Adott modellek exportálása

Ha konkrét strukturálatlan dokumentumfeldolgozási modelleket szeretne exportálni egy tartalomközpontból egy PnP-sablonba, használja a következő PnP PowerShell-parancsmagokat :

Connect-PnPOnline -Url "https://contoso.sharepoint.com/sites/yourContentCenter"

Get-PnPSiteTemplate -Out MyModels.pnp -Configuration .\extract.json

A extract.json határozza meg az exportálni kívánt modelleket, lehetővé téve a modell név vagy azonosító szerinti megadását, és opcionálisan úgy konfigurálható, hogy ne nyerjen ki betanítási adatokat.

Példa – Modell megadása név alapján

{
    "$schema": "https://developer.microsoft.com/en-us/json-schemas/pnp/provisioning/202102/extract-configuration.schema.json",
    "persistAssetFiles": true,
    "handlers": [        
        "SyntexModels"
    ],
    "syntexModels": {
        "models": [
            {
                "name": "Sample - benefits change notice.classifier"
            }
        ]
    }
}

Példa – Modell megadása azonosító alapján

{
    "$schema": "https://developer.microsoft.com/en-us/json-schemas/pnp/provisioning/202102/extract-configuration.schema.json",
    "persistAssetFiles": true,
    "handlers": [        
        "SyntexModels"
    ],
    "syntexModels": {
        "models": [
            {
                "id": 3,
                "excludeTrainingData": true
            }
        ]
    }
}

Ha nem adja meg az "includeTrainingData" tulajdonságot, az alapértelmezett viselkedés a belefoglalás.

Megjegyzés:

A betanítási adatok szükségesek ahhoz, hogy a modell szerkeszthető legyen a cél tartalomközpontba való importáláskor.

Modellek importálása tartalomközpontba

A PnP-sablonokba exportált strukturálatlan dokumentumfeldolgozási modellek bármely bérlő tartalomközpontjába importálhatók. Ha az exportálás betanítási adatokat tartalmazott, akkor a modell az importálás után szerkeszthető lesz.

Modell importálásához használja a következő parancsokat:

Connect-PnPOnline -Url "https://contoso.sharepoint.com/sites/yourContentCenter"

Invoke-PnPSiteTemplate -Path .\sampleModel.pnp